lp:~benji/lazr.restful/tweak-etag
Created by
Benji York
and last modified
- Get this branch:
- bzr branch lp:~benji/lazr.restful/tweak-etag
Only
Benji York
can upload to this branch. If you are
Benji York
please log in for upload directions.
Branch merges
Propose for merging
No branches
dependent on this one.
- Paul Hummer (community): Approve
-
Diff: 527 lines (+347/-51)6 files modifiedsrc/lazr/restful/_resource.py (+61/-48)
src/lazr/restful/testing/helpers.py (+12/-0)
src/lazr/restful/tests/test_etag.py (+253/-0)
src/lazr/restful/tests/test_utils.py (+15/-3)
src/lazr/restful/utils.py (+5/-0)
versions.cfg (+1/-0)
Branch information
Recent revisions
- 154. By Benji York <benji@benji-laptop>
-
add tests for how conditional reads and conditional writes work plus some
small cleanups - 153. By Benji York <benji@benji-laptop>
-
tweak ETag generation so entities depend on read-only fields instead of
revno because read-only fields change less frequently. - 150. By Benji York <benji@benji-laptop>
-
refactored the ETag generation for EntryResource to make it more
testable and wrote tests for it - 149. By Benji York <benji@benji-laptop>
-
- change the way ETags are generated so the version is used in fewer places
(an optimization)
- small refactoring of the ETag comparison code
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p:lazr.restful